Frequently Asked Questions

I have never practiced at a private residence. How does this work?

My home has several areas suitable for enjoying Hood Canal while practicing yoga.  It won't be much different than going to a studio, except its much more scenic here!

After we agree on a date/time, I will ask you to complete a form /waiver to sign, and I will collect your contact information as well.  I accept cash, Venmo & Zelle. A gov't-issued photo ID is required upon arrival to class.  

In what area of Hood Canal is the class located and is there parking?

The home is located on Highway 101, just North of Hoodsport.  Guests at The Glen Resort can walk here!  There is parking for 2 cars.  So, if you have 3 in your group, 2 will need to ride together.

What days are classes taught?

Mon-Fri: Class times available between 9am and 6 pm

Sat:  Various class times available depending on the date.

Sun: Classes aren't typically taught on Sundays, but if that is the only day that works for you, then I should be able to accommodate!

For an indoor class, what is the ambience like?

The primary purpose of the room is to practice yoga, though I do have some furniture in here.  It shouldn't feel any different than a 'regular' yoga studio, though this one likely has a nicer view :-)

Do you provide yoga mats and blocks?

Yoga mats and  blocks are provided but you are welcome to use your own if you wish.    Filtered water is available to fill up your bottle.

Is your home allergen-free?

We have 2 cats who spend 90% of their time on the ground floor, where classes are not held.  But the practice room probably isn't 100% free of cat dander.  Note that I am actually allergic to cats so I am always on the hunt for cat hair to dispose of it.

We do not have any carpet in the house, so as to minimize dust getting trapped and held in fibers.
